Output 1bfb95245cbb912147dbf1394c0c12e605946eefc530930dcaebdae96581789a:1

value
17889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bea5a4ab02ac134612332b97a897cd19068891 OP_EQUAL
address
3PYfonCNLC4WYfp75qjqWjNvorQwKeYHPe
transaction
1bfb95245cbb912147dbf1394c0c12e605946eefc530930dcaebdae96581789a
spent
true